NBA suspensions for the Pistons-Hornets fight, sources tell ESPN:

Isaiah Stewart: 7 games

Miles Bridges: 4 games

Moussa Diabate: 4 games

Jalen Duren: 2 games

7 games for Stewart is low. I thought he'd get no less than 10 factoring in how soft Silver is. He should have gotten 15, at a minimum.

I don't miss David Stern often but when it comes to player misconduct, he was consistently heavy handed. Duran probably would have gotten 5, Diabete would have around 7, Bridges about 10, and Stewart 20 under Stern.

This won't dissuade Stewart, or anyone, in the future. Only 3 more games than anyone else when he literally ran on the court, which is an automatic 1 game on it's own, though is a bit mind boggling.

Suspension amounts:

Isaiah Stewart: $724,138

Miles Bridges: $689,655

Jalen Duren: $89,423

Moussa Diabate: $62,641

BREAKING: Utah Jazz star Jaren Jackson Jr. is likely to miss the remainder of the season to undergo surgery on his left knee to ensure his longterm health after a localized PVNS growth was discovered post trade, league sources tell me.

On Feb. 7 and 9, the Jazz removed Lauri Markkanen and Jaren Jackson Jr. before the beginning of the fourth quarter and did not return them to the game. The Pacers were fined for violating the player participation policy for holding out Pascal Siakam and two other starters Feb. 3.
